Ashley Morrow

H.O.P.E Honoree

Ashley (Arnold) Morrow is a passionate community advocate whose work reflects a deep commitment to service, empowerment, and environmental stewardship throughout the Mahoning Valley. As the founder of Ashley’s Peer Recovery Services LLC, she has dedicated herself to supporting individuals on their journey toward recovery, offering guidance, encouragement, and resources to those working to rebuild their lives. Through her leadership and compassion, Ashley has helped create pathways of hope and healing for many within the community.

Beyond her work in recovery services, Ashley has been instrumental in fostering connections among women and environmental advocates. She is the founder of the Wild Ones Youngstown Area Chapter, an organization focused on promoting native plants and sustainable landscapes that benefit local ecosystems. She is also the co-founder of The Spore Sisterhood and The Spore Sorority, initiatives designed to build community among women who share a passion for nature, education, and personal growth.

In addition to her community leadership, Ashley works professionally at Livi Steel, Inc. and serves as a brand ambassador for Dwell and a professional affiliate for The Nokbox. Through these roles, she continues to build relationships and support initiatives that strengthen both individuals and the broader community.

Ashley is also a strong advocate for animal welfare and actively supports local efforts to ensure adequate shelter and care for animals, particularly during the harsh winter months in Northeast Ohio. Her work consistently reflects a belief that compassion should extend not only to people, but to all living things.

When she is not working or volunteering, Ashley enjoys spending time with her family and friends and embracing the natural beauty of the outdoors. Through her many roles and initiatives, she continues to inspire others to lead with kindness, connection, and purpose.
